Course contents :
 |
| The aim of the course is to provide 1) a historical landscape of the book production in Belgium from Plantin to Casterman ; 2) a close analysis of contemporary belgian book industry. |
 |
Learning outcomes of the course :
 |
| 1) Developing an in-depth knowledge of the international publishing industry as well as within the Belgium and French editorial fields;
2) Considering the publishing industry from the two points of view of economical constraints and sociology of practices;
3) Acquiring a practical knowledge of a moving professional field. |
